Etymology[edit]

From feoil (flesh, meat) +‎ -mhar (adjectival suffix).

Adjective[edit]

feolmhar (genitive singular masculine feolmhair, genitive singular feminine feolmhaire, plural feolmhara, comparative feolmhaire)

  1. fleshy, meaty; fat, flabby, plump, rotund
